Shepherd’s Salad Recipe
Serves: 6 | Course:
Starters | Total time (min.): 10 | Complexity (1 to 3): 1 |
Tool
Food Processors
Ingredients
- 1 cucumber
- 1 green pepper, cut to fit the feed tube
- 1 red onion
- 4 medium tomatoes
- 3 spring onions, finely chopped
- Handful of flat leaf parsley, coarsely chopped
- 2 Tbsp Extra virgin olive oil
- Juice of ½ lemon
- 1tsp ground sumac
- Salt and pepper to taste
Method
- Fit the drive shaft and bowl onto the power unit.
- Add the dicing disc and fit the lid.
- Fit the dicing grid into the feed tube.
- With the machine running at max speed, use the Express DiceTM pusher to push the cucumber, green pepper, red onion and tomatoes through the dicing grid - place both hands on top of the pusher and press down firmly.
- Work in batches, transferring the contents of the processor bowl into a large mixing bowl as necessary.
- Using the knife blade, finely chop the spring onions and parsley.
- Combine the cucumber, tomatoes, spring onions and parsley in a medium mixing bowl.
- Add the olive oil and lemon juice, season with salt and pepper and mix well.
- Transfer to a serving dish, then sprinkle the ground sumac over the top.
